PTFE Sheet for Chemical, Thermal & Electrical Applications

PTFE sheet is a solid sheet material manufactured from polytetrafluoroethylene resin. It is selected for applications requiring outstanding chemical resistance, wide temperature range, low friction coefficient, non-stick surface and excellent electrical insulation properties.

PTFE sheet is available in virgin (unfilled) and filled grades. Filled grades incorporate additives such as glass fiber, carbon, graphite, bronze or molybdenum disulfide to improve specific properties including wear resistance, compressive strength, thermal conductivity and dimensional stability.

Why Choose PTFE Sheet?

PTFE sheet combines outstanding chemical resistance, wide temperature capability, low friction and excellent dielectric properties for demanding industrial applications.

01

Chemical Inertness

PTFE is resistant to virtually all industrial chemicals, including strong acids, bases, solvents and oxidizing agents, making it suitable for aggressive media.

02

Wide Temperature Range

PTFE maintains its properties over a temperature range from approximately -180°C to +260°C, suitable for both cryogenic and high-temperature service.

03

Low Coefficient of Friction

PTFE has one of the lowest coefficients of friction of any solid material, typically between 0.05 and 0.10, reducing wear and energy loss.

04

Non-Stick Surface

The non-stick properties of PTFE prevent adhesion of most substances, making it easy to clean and ideal for anti-stick applications.

05

Excellent Electrical Insulation

PTFE exhibits high dielectric strength, low dielectric constant and low dissipation factor, making it ideal for high-frequency and high-voltage insulation.

06

Filled Grades Available

Glass, carbon, graphite, bronze and other fillers can be added to PTFE to improve wear resistance, compressive strength, thermal conductivity and dimensional stability.

Technical Specifications

PTFE Sheet Specifications

Technical properties depend on the PTFE grade (virgin or filled), manufacturing method and sheet thickness. The values below are typical for standard virgin PTFE sheet and should be confirmed for the selected grade before ordering.

Product PTFE Sheet (Virgin / Filled)
Material Virgin PTFE or filled PTFE (glass fiber, carbon, graphite, bronze, MoS₂ etc. depending on grade)
Color White / Natural for virgin PTFE; filled grades may be gray, black, brown or other colors
Density Approximately 2.1–2.3 g/cm³ for virgin PTFE; filled grades may vary depending on filler type and content
Temperature Range Continuous service: -180°C to +260°C; short-term tolerance up to +300°C depending on application and load
Tensile Strength ≥ 15 MPa for virgin PTFE sheet (typical 25–35 MPa); filled grades may vary
Elongation at Break ≥ 150% for virgin PTFE (typical 200–400%); filled grades typically lower
Hardness Shore D 50–65 for virgin PTFE; filled grades may be higher
Coefficient of Friction 0.05–0.10 (dynamic) for virgin PTFE against steel
Dielectric Strength 18–60 kV/mm depending on thickness and test conditions
Chemical Resistance Virtually inert to all chemicals except molten alkali metals, elemental fluorine and some fluorine compounds at elevated temperatures
Water Absorption < 0.01% (virtually zero)

Manufacturing

Controlled Production for Consistent Quality

Consistent material composition, density, surface finish and dimensional accuracy are important for reliable PTFE sheet performance.

PROCESS / 01

Resin Selection

Virgin PTFE resin or filled compounds are selected according to the required grade and performance specifications.

PROCESS / 02

Molding / Skiving

PTFE sheet is produced by compression molding and sintering, or skiving from molded billets for thin gauges and film.

PROCESS / 03

Inspection & Testing

Finished sheet is checked for thickness tolerance, density, tensile strength, surface quality and other specified properties.

    Frequently Asked Questions About PTFE Sheet

    What is PTFE sheet?
    PTFE sheet is a solid sheet material made from polytetrafluoroethylene resin. It is used for gaskets, seals, linings, bearings, insulators and machined components requiring chemical resistance, low friction and wide temperature capability.
    What is the temperature range of PTFE sheet?
    PTFE sheet can be used continuously from -180°C to +260°C, with short-term tolerance up to +300°C depending on load and application conditions.
    What chemicals is PTFE sheet resistant to?
    PTFE is virtually inert to almost all chemicals, including strong acids, bases, solvents and oxidizing agents. It is only attacked by molten alkali metals, elemental fluorine and some fluorine compounds at elevated temperatures.
    What is the difference between virgin and filled PTFE sheet?
    Virgin PTFE offers the best chemical resistance and electrical properties. Filled PTFE incorporates additives such as glass, carbon, graphite or bronze to improve wear resistance, compressive strength, thermal conductivity and dimensional stability.
